Online learning at a higher level

Press release

On 18 February 2015, Dr W. Dirksen, Director of the Faculty of Veterinary Medicine at Utrecht University, the management of the Department of Clinical Sciences of Companion Animals of this faculty and André Romijn, Publishing Director of VetVisuals© International, signed an agreement to create an educational partnership combining the respective strengths of each party. The aim of this innovative collaboration is to produce and deliver engaging, high quality, interactive multimedia teaching modules in the field of veterinary medicine.

Efficient learning

Online education is increasingly becoming part of the student experience.  When well organized, online learning coupled with education on location (blended learning) can be much more efficient than traditional teaching methods alone. Having the right kind of visual support – for example, instructional videos showing clinical procedures – can help veterinary students in being better prepared for practice. Similarly, online resources can help graduate veterinarians to keep up to date and better informed of the latest veterinary developments. Through the offer of a professional, objective and practical postgraduate training package, every companion animal vet will benefit from the knowledge and skills of the Department of Clinical Sciences of Companion Animals of Utrecht’s Faculty of Veterinary Medicine. With sophisticated online learning modules, every small animal practitioner will have the opportunity to refresh their skills and learning as and when needed. The programmes being developed as a result of this partnership will be announced later this year.

Top in the veterinary world

The Faculty of Veterinary Medicine (FD) of Utrecht University is the only institution in the Netherlands providing veterinary training. The programme is accredited by American (AVMA), Canadian (CVMA) and European (EAEVE) bodies. The FD is a leader in Europe and ranks amongst the top veterinary institutes in the world. The University Clinic for Companion Animals is the largest and most modern animal hospital in Europe.

Leading learning publisher

Based in the United Kingdom, VetVisuals© International is a global provider of interactive veterinary CPD education and online veterinary courses. Delivered via a unique Learning Management System, its videos, articles and courses offer in-depth coverage of common veterinary clinical problems and are presented by leading international veterinary specialists, recognised by the profession as experts in their field. VetVisuals© also publishes evidence-based articles and interesting case studies covering the latest developments in research, diagnoses and therapies, all with a practical touch and written for general practitioners. In order to keep objective standards high, there is no industry sponsorship. The VetVisuals© business model is based on subscription and course fees only.

In 2013 VetVisuals© International signed a Memorandum of Understanding regarding an educational partnership with the Centre for Veterinary Education (CVE) at the University of Sydney.
